The Official Free Tool: exocad view The only truly "free" software offered by the company is exocad view , a 3D dental file viewer. What it does: Allows you to view and share 3D dental scans and designs. While exocad is a premium, professional-grade dental CAD software, there are specific ways to access its tools and training resources for free. As of late 2023, the official demo dongles have been discontinued, meaning there is no longer a standard "free trial" for the full software . Accessing Free Resources

Free Learning Resources: The exocad student portal offers free webinars and learning options to help beginners understand digital dentistry workflows. 3. Third-Party "Free" Bundles
